Two IAF jawans die in road mishap

Jind, Dec 11 (UNI) Two Indian Air Force personnel were killed in a head-on collision between a truck and car near Sanjuma village on Sunam highway in Sangrur district of Punjab on Wednesday morning.
The deceased have been identified as Chirag Nain and Kamaldeep Singh Brar.
Chirag, who joined the IAF two years ago, was posted at Barmar in Rajasthan and was on leave. He along with his three friends had gone to Patiala in Punjab to attend the marriage of his friend. The accident occurred this morning when they were returning to their native villages after attending the marriage function.
